  • (1888PressRelease) June 05, 2026 - VERONA, New York - The 2026 Empire State Tribute Festival brings a wealth of live entertainment and tribute performances alongside championship-level competition this summer. Running from July 30 to August 2, the host Turning Stone Resort Casino in Verona will transform into a bevy of Las Vegas-style showroom acts.

    All Event Passholders will have access to five major concerts, as well as the Images of the King World Championship. These acts will broaden this year’s festival, elevating the experience for longtime fans and attracting new audiences eager to share in the music.

    “Our festival is more of an immersive experience built around live music than a tribute,” says Festival Organizer Jason Sherry. “We blend world-class performers who are deeply passionate about the stage with storytelling and nostalgia. This will be an experience no one will forget.”

    The Images of the King World Championships is an Elvis Tribute Artist Contest that serves as the festival’s centerpiece. It brings in the best Elvis tribute performances and puts them through multiple rounds of competitions and live concerts. This is a highly competitive and internationally regarded performance category that often launches many careers. Everything kicks off with the opening night concert “Welcome to My World” featuring concerts by champions Dwight Icenhower, Diogo Light, Robert Washington, Nick Perkins, Jordan Poole, Dan Fontaine and Irv Cass hosted by Dan Barrella and backed by the EAS Band.

    One of the more anticipated concerts takes place on night two with the 1988 Comeback Special. This is a concert reimagining an alternate universe where Elvis retired in 1977 due to health concerns, but returned more than 10 years later, happier and ready to shake the stage. It is followed by an after-hours party in the Tuscarora Ball Room hosted by Dan Barrella.

    “We want to offer a range of tributes and music that offer everything an Elvis purist would want, as well as electric ideas that excite those who dream of the King shaking his hips still,” continues Sherry. “The goal is a more dynamic entertainment event that feels engaging for the entire festival.”

    As part of the five-concert series, organizers have designed a Follow the Yellow Brick Road musical tribute to Elton John. The production stars Dwight Icenhower as “Captain Fantastic,” tracing the decades-spanning career of this musical dynamo through a live concert featuring beloved songs and John’s signature stage presence.

    About Empire State Tribute Festival - The Empire State Tribute Festival is one of North America’s premier tribute entertainment events. It brings together award-winning performances, tribute artists and fans for a multi-day celebration of legendary music. Growing out of the long-running Lake George Elvis Festival, the event is now a large-scale entertainment experience honoring some of the most iconic artists and musicians.
